JA Duffy

ยท

'20 '21 '22 '23 '24 '25 '26
T20I
ODI
HND
TESTS
IPL

Career Totals

JA Duffy career totals across all leagues
Batting Balls Batting Fours Batting Not Out Batting Position Batting Runs Batting Sixes Bowling Balls Bowling Maidens Bowling Noballs Bowling Runs Bowling Wickets Bowling Wides Fielding Catches Fielding Runouts Match Played
166 19 11 217 130 0 2,998 58 19 2,800 135 112 20 4 78

By Season

JA Duffy stats by season
Season Batting Balls Batting Fours Batting Not Out Batting Position Batting Runs Batting Sixes Bowling Balls Bowling Maidens Bowling Noballs Bowling Runs Bowling Wickets Bowling Wides Fielding Catches Fielding Runouts Match Played
T20I 2020 โ€” โ€” โ€” โ€” โ€” โ€” 24 0 0 33 4 1 โ€” โ€” 1
T20I 2021 5 0 0 11 3 0 54 0 0 42 1 1 โ€” โ€” 3
ODI 2022 โ€” โ€” โ€” โ€” โ€” โ€” 100 1 3 104 4 9 โ€” 1 2
T20I 2022 โ€” โ€” โ€” โ€” โ€” โ€” 78 0 2 113 4 2 2 โ€” 4
ODI 2023 6 0 1 20 1 0 186 0 2 217 7 4 โ€” โ€” 4
T20I 2023 3 1 1 10 6 0 24 0 0 35 1 2 1 โ€” 2
ODI 2024 10 2 2 22 8 0 80 0 0 77 3 3 โ€” โ€” 2
T20I 2024 11 1 1 20 8 0 132 0 0 153 8 8 5 1 6
HND 2025 1 0 0 11 0 0 120 0 0 180 8 10 3 1 7
ODI 2025 4 0 1 10 3 0 496 7 2 451 21 23 4 1 11
T20I 2025 9 0 3 54 7 0 424 1 0 528 35 24 4 โ€” 20
TESTS 2025 104 14 0 26 78 0 1030 49 9 407 25 8 โ€” โ€” 4
IPL 2026 โ€” โ€” โ€” โ€” โ€” โ€” 72 0 1 138 6 7 1 โ€” 3
T20I 2026 13 1 2 33 16 0 178 0 0 322 8 10 โ€” โ€” 9

Game Log

JA Duffy game-by-game statistics
Season Wk League Matchup Score Batting Balls Batting Fours Batting Not Out Batting Position Batting Runs Batting Sixes Bowling Balls Bowling Maidens Bowling Noballs Bowling Runs Bowling Wickets Bowling Wides Fielding Catches Fielding Runouts Match Played
2020 Wk 1
2020 1 T20I Pakistan @ New Zealand 153โ€“156 24.0 0.0 0.0 33.0 4.0 1.0 1.0
2021 Wk 1
2021 1 T20I New Zealand @ Bangladesh 60โ€“62 5.0 0.0 0.0 11.0 3.0 0.0 6.0 0.0 0.0 3.0 0.0 1.0 1.0
2021 1 T20I New Zealand @ Bangladesh 128โ€“76 24.0 0.0 0.0 14.0 0.0 0.0 1.0
2021 1 T20I New Zealand @ Bangladesh 161โ€“134 24.0 0.0 0.0 25.0 1.0 0.0 1.0
2022 Wk 1
2022 1 ODI Ireland @ New Zealand 216โ€“219 54.0 1.0 3.0 52.0 1.0 4.0 1.0 1.0
2022 1 ODI Scotland @ New Zealand 306โ€“307 46.0 0.0 0.0 52.0 3.0 5.0 1.0
2022 1 T20I New Zealand @ Ireland 173โ€“142 18.0 0.0 0.0 22.0 1.0 1.0 1.0
2022 1 T20I New Zealand @ Ireland 179โ€“91 18.0 0.0 0.0 20.0 2.0 0.0 1.0
2022 1 T20I Ireland @ New Zealand 174โ€“180 24.0 0.0 2.0 47.0 1.0 1.0 1.0 1.0
2022 1 T20I New Zealand @ Scotland 254โ€“152 18.0 0.0 0.0 24.0 0.0 0.0 1.0 1.0
2023 Wk 1
2023 1 ODI India @ New Zealand 385โ€“295 2.0 0.0 0.0 10.0 0.0 0.0 60.0 0.0 0.0 100.0 3.0 1.0 1.0
2023 1 ODI New Zealand @ Bangladesh 239โ€“200 36.0 0.0 0.0 39.0 1.0 0.0 1.0
2023 1 ODI Bangladesh @ New Zealand 291โ€“296 60.0 0.0 0.0 51.0 3.0 1.0 1.0
2023 1 ODI New Zealand @ Bangladesh 98โ€“99 4.0 0.0 1.0 10.0 1.0 0.0 30.0 0.0 2.0 27.0 0.0 2.0 1.0
2023 1 T20I New Zealand @ India 176โ€“155 18.0 0.0 0.0 27.0 1.0 2.0 1.0 1.0
2023 1 T20I New Zealand @ India 99โ€“101 3.0 1.0 1.0 10.0 6.0 0.0 6.0 0.0 0.0 8.0 0.0 0.0 1.0
2024 Wk 1
2024 1 ODI Sri Lanka @ New Zealand 324โ€“175 3.0 1.0 1.0 11.0 4.0 0.0 50.0 0.0 0.0 41.0 3.0 1.0 1.0
2024 1 ODI New Zealand @ Sri Lanka 209โ€“210 7.0 1.0 1.0 11.0 4.0 0.0 30.0 0.0 0.0 36.0 0.0 2.0 1.0
2024 1 T20I New Zealand @ Pakistan 90โ€“92 10.0 1.0 1.0 9.0 8.0 0.0 12.0 0.0 0.0 7.0 0.0 0.0 1.0
2024 1 T20I Pakistan @ New Zealand 178โ€“179 24.0 0.0 0.0 39.0 1.0 1.0 2.0 1.0
2024 1 T20I New Zealand @ Pakistan 178โ€“174 24.0 0.0 0.0 42.0 0.0 2.0 1.0 1.0 1.0
2024 1 T20I New Zealand @ Sri Lanka 135โ€“140 1.0 0.0 0.0 11.0 0.0 0.0 24.0 0.0 0.0 29.0 0.0 1.0 1.0
2024 1 T20I New Zealand @ Sri Lanka 172โ€“164 24.0 0.0 0.0 21.0 3.0 1.0 1.0 1.0
2024 1 T20I New Zealand @ Sri Lanka 186โ€“141 24.0 0.0 0.0 15.0 4.0 3.0 1.0 1.0
2025 Wk 1
2025 1 HND Southern Brave @ Northern Superchargers 139โ€“141 20.0 0.0 0.0 26.0 3.0 2.0 1.0 1.0
2025 1 HND Northern Superchargers @ Birmingham Phoenix 193โ€“157 20.0 0.0 0.0 31.0 2.0 2.0 2.0 1.0
2025 1 HND Manchester Originals @ Northern Superchargers 171โ€“114 1.0 0.0 0.0 11.0 0.0 0.0 20.0 0.0 0.0 36.0 0.0 3.0 1.0
2025 1 HND London Spirit @ Northern Superchargers 135โ€“138 20.0 0.0 0.0 24.0 0.0 0.0 1.0
2025 1 HND Northern Superchargers @ Oval Invincibles 198โ€“182 20.0 0.0 0.0 39.0 2.0 0.0 1.0 1.0
2025 1 HND Northern Superchargers @ Manchester Originals 139โ€“140 15.0 0.0 0.0 16.0 1.0 2.0 1.0
2025 1 HND Northern Superchargers @ Trent Rockets 119โ€“12 5.0 0.0 0.0 8.0 0.0 1.0 1.0
2025 1 ODI Sri Lanka @ New Zealand 178โ€“180 52.0 1.0 0.0 39.0 2.0 2.0 1.0
2025 1 ODI New Zealand @ Sri Lanka 255โ€“142 30.0 1.0 0.0 30.0 2.0 0.0 1.0
2025 1 ODI Pakistan @ New Zealand 242โ€“243 42.0 0.0 1.0 48.0 1.0 1.0 1.0 1.0
2025 1 ODI New Zealand @ Pakistan 344โ€“271 4.0 0.0 1.0 10.0 3.0 0.0 54.0 0.0 0.0 57.0 2.0 2.0 1.0 1.0 1.0
2025 1 ODI New Zealand @ Pakistan 292โ€“208 48.0 1.0 0.0 35.0 3.0 2.0 1.0
2025 1 ODI New Zealand @ Pakistan 264โ€“221 42.0 0.0 0.0 40.0 2.0 1.0 2.0 1.0
2025 1 ODI England @ New Zealand 223โ€“224 36.0 0.0 1.0 55.0 3.0 6.0 1.0
2025 1 ODI England @ New Zealand 175โ€“177 36.0 2.0 0.0 16.0 1.0 1.0 1.0
2025 1 ODI England @ New Zealand 222โ€“226 60.0 0.0 0.0 56.0 3.0 2.0 1.0
2025 1 ODI New Zealand @ West Indies 269โ€“262 54.0 2.0 0.0 48.0 0.0 5.0 1.0
2025 1 ODI West Indies @ New Zealand 161โ€“162 42.0 0.0 0.0 27.0 2.0 1.0 1.0
2025 1 T20I Sri Lanka @ New Zealand 218โ€“211 24.0 0.0 0.0 30.0 1.0 1.0 1.0
2025 1 T20I Pakistan @ New Zealand 91โ€“92 22.0 0.0 0.0 14.0 4.0 2.0 1.0
2025 1 T20I Pakistan @ New Zealand 135โ€“137 18.0 0.0 0.0 20.0 2.0 1.0 1.0 1.0
2025 1 T20I New Zealand @ Pakistan 204โ€“207 4.0 0.0 0.0 10.0 2.0 0.0 18.0 0.0 0.0 37.0 1.0 0.0 1.0
2025 1 T20I New Zealand @ Pakistan 220โ€“105 24.0 0.0 0.0 20.0 4.0 2.0 1.0
2025 1 T20I Pakistan @ New Zealand 128โ€“131 24.0 0.0 0.0 18.0 2.0 1.0 1.0
2025 1 T20I New Zealand @ South Africa 173โ€“152 24.0 0.0 0.0 20.0 3.0 1.0 1.0
2025 1 T20I Zimbabwe @ New Zealand 120โ€“122 18.0 0.0 0.0 17.0 0.0 1.0 1.0 1.0
2025 1 T20I South Africa @ New Zealand 134โ€“135 24.0 0.0 0.0 33.0 2.0 1.0 1.0 1.0
2025 1 T20I New Zealand @ South Africa 180โ€“177 24.0 0.0 0.0 36.0 1.0 2.0 1.0
2025 1 T20I New Zealand @ Australia 181โ€“185 18.0 0.0 0.0 31.0 0.0 1.0 1.0
2025 1 T20I Australia @ New Zealand 16โ€“0 6.0 0.0 0.0 13.0 1.0 0.0 1.0
2025 1 T20I New Zealand @ Australia 156โ€“160 1.0 0.0 1.0 11.0 1.0 0.0 24.0 0.0 0.0 29.0 2.0 1.0 1.0
2025 1 T20I England @ New Zealand 153โ€“0 24.0 0.0 0.0 45.0 1.0 2.0 1.0
2025 1 T20I England @ New Zealand 236โ€“171 2.0 0.0 0.0 11.0 1.0 0.0 24.0 0.0 0.0 44.0 1.0 1.0 1.0
2025 1 T20I West Indies @ New Zealand 164โ€“157 1.0 0.0 1.0 11.0 1.0 0.0 24.0 0.0 0.0 19.0 2.0 3.0 1.0
2025 1 T20I New Zealand @ West Indies 207โ€“204 24.0 1.0 0.0 21.0 1.0 0.0 1.0 1.0
2025 1 T20I New Zealand @ West Indies 177โ€“168 1.0 0.0 1.0 11.0 2.0 0.0 24.0 0.0 0.0 36.0 3.0 1.0 1.0
2025 1 T20I West Indies @ New Zealand 38โ€“0 12.0 0.0 0.0 10.0 0.0 1.0 1.0
2025 1 T20I West Indies @ New Zealand 140โ€“141 24.0 0.0 0.0 35.0 4.0 2.0 1.0
2025 1 TESTS Zimbabwe @ New Zealand 242โ€“601 55.0 6.0 0.0 3.0 36.0 0.0 103.0 3.0 2.0 52.0 2.0 1.0 1.0
2025 1 TESTS New Zealand @ West Indies 697โ€“624 11.0 3.0 0.0 11.0 14.0 0.0 364.0 18.0 3.0 156.0 8.0 1.0 1.0
2025 1 TESTS West Indies @ New Zealand 333โ€“335 13.0 2.0 0.0 9.0 11.0 0.0 218.0 9.0 2.0 71.0 6.0 2.0 1.0
2025 1 TESTS New Zealand @ West Indies 881โ€“558 25.0 3.0 0.0 3.0 17.0 0.0 345.0 19.0 2.0 128.0 9.0 4.0 1.0
2026 Wk 1
2026 1 IPL Sunrisers Hyderabad @ Royal Challengers Bengaluru 201โ€“203 24.0 0.0 0.0 22.0 3.0 1.0 1.0
2026 1 IPL Royal Challengers Bengaluru @ Chennai Super Kings 250โ€“207 24.0 0.0 1.0 58.0 2.0 2.0 1.0
2026 1 IPL Royal Challengers Bengaluru @ Mumbai Indians 240โ€“222 24.0 0.0 0.0 58.0 1.0 4.0 1.0 1.0
2026 1 T20I India @ New Zealand 238โ€“190 24.0 0.0 0.0 27.0 2.0 3.0 1.0
2026 1 T20I New Zealand @ India 208โ€“209 24.0 0.0 0.0 38.0 1.0 1.0 1.0
2026 1 T20I New Zealand @ India 153โ€“155 3.0 0.0 1.0 11.0 4.0 0.0 12.0 0.0 0.0 38.0 0.0 0.0 1.0
2026 1 T20I New Zealand @ India 215โ€“165 22.0 0.0 0.0 33.0 2.0 0.0 1.0
2026 1 T20I India @ New Zealand 271โ€“225 5.0 1.0 1.0 11.0 9.0 0.0 24.0 0.0 0.0 53.0 1.0 1.0 1.0
2026 1 T20I United Arab Emirates @ New Zealand 173โ€“175 12.0 0.0 0.0 16.0 1.0 2.0 1.0
2026 1 T20I New Zealand @ South Africa 175โ€“178 18.0 0.0 0.0 50.0 0.0 2.0 1.0
2026 1 T20I Canada @ New Zealand 173โ€“176 24.0 0.0 0.0 25.0 1.0 0.0 1.0
2026 1 T20I India @ New Zealand 255โ€“159 5.0 0.0 0.0 11.0 3.0 0.0 18.0 0.0 0.0 42.0 0.0 1.0 1.0